The tables below provide a detailed look at Graves County's labor force, unemployment rates, commuting patterns, and employment by industry.
2020 | 2021 | 2022 | 2023 | 2024 |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
Labor Market Area | 356,332 | 355,347 | 355,015 | 356,227 | 356,672 |
Graves County | 36,649 | 36,634 | 36,412 | 36,612 | 36,630 |
Mayfield | 9,729 | 9,971 | 9,894 | 9,905 | 9,868 |
Source: US Census Bureau - 2020 Decennial Census (2020), Annual Estimates of the Resident Population (2016 - 2019), American Community Survey, ESRI
Graves County | Labor Market Area |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|
2022 | 2025 | 2022 | 2025 | |
Total Civilian Labor Force | 15,602 | 16,586 | 152,215 | 161,269 |
Employed | 15,052 | 15,529 | 147,874 | 153,609 |
Unemployed | 550 | 757 | 5,341 | 7,741 |
Unemployment Rate (%) | 3.5% | 3.9% | 3.6% | 4.4% |
Source: U.S. Department of Labor, Bureau of Labor Statistics - Local Area Unemployment Statistics (LAUS) and ESRI
Year | Graves County | Labor Market Area | Kentucky | U.S. |
|---|---|---|---|---|
2020 | 5.9 | 6.7 | 6.6 | 6.7 |
2021 | 3.5 | 3.8 | 4.1 | 3.9 |
2022 | 3.5 | 3.7 | 3.9 | 3.5 |
2023 | 4.0 | 4.2 | 3.8 | 3.6 |
2024 | 4.6 | 4.8 | 5.1 | 4.0 |
Source: U.S. Department of Labor, Bureau of Labor Statistics - Local Area Unemployment Statistics (LAUS)

Q3 2025 Jobs | Average Annual Wages | Average Weekly Wages | Location Quotient | % of Total Employment |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
Agriculture, Forestry, Fishing and Hunting | 689 | $64,214 | 1235 | 4.26 | 5.08% |
Mining, Quarrying, and Oil and Gas Extraction | 30 | $68,203 | 1312 | 0.62 | 0.22% |
Utilities | 210 | $111,782 | 2150 | 2.96 | 1.55% |
Construction | 724 | $50,172 | 965 | 0.89 | 5.34% |
Manufacturing | 2,332 | $51,865 | 997 | 2.22 | 17.21% |
Wholesale Trade | 698 | $70,119 | 1348 | 1.39 | 5.15% |
Retail Trade | 1,544 | $39,579 | 761 | 1.19 | 11.39% |
Transportation and Warehousing | 687 | $52,863 | 1017 | 1.00 | 5.07% |
Information | 143 | $65,496 | 1260 | 0.56 | 1.06% |
Finance and Insurance | 411 | $58,574 | 1126 | 0.77 | 3.03% |
Real Estate and Rental and Leasing | 118 | $49,603 | 954 | 0.50 | 0.87% |
Professional, Scientific, and Technical Services | 401 | $67,321 | 1295 | 0.40 | 2.86% |
Management of Companies and Enterprises | 102 | $76,075 | 1463 | 0.48 | 0.75% |
Administrative and Support and Waste Management | 550 | $43,507 | 837 | 0.68 | 4.06% |
Educational Services | 935 | $44,533 | 856 | 0.85 | 6.90% |
Health Care and Social Assistance | 1,483 | $57,838 | 1112 | 0.71 | 10.94% |
Arts, Entertainment, and Recreation | 195 | $19,636 | 378 | 0.68 | 1.44% |
Accommodation and Food Services | 1,111 | $17,695 | 340 | 0.95 | 8.20% |
Other Services (except Public Administration) | 610 | $44,737 | 860 | 1.06 | 4.50% |
Public Administration | 590 | $54,517 | 1048 | 0.92 | 4.35% |
Unclassified | 590 | $54,517 | 1048 | 0.92 | 4.35% |
Source: JobsEQ
